Bead Stringing Projects
Looking for freelance Bead Stringing jobs and project work? PeoplePerHour has you covered.
Translate from English to Russian
We have around 705 source keys in two projects containing stings in English for an Android Music app and Video app. We use a platform called Localazy for translation, so the strings cannot be sent in an offline format (.docx or .exel), all translations have to be made on that platform itself. The strings need to be translated into Russian. Please note that the translated content will be proof-read and JUST copy-pasting from Google Translate will not be appreciated and the payment can be withheld.
22 days ago52 proposalsRemoteopportunity
Food supplement packaging
I am looking for a designer to design food supplement packaging. - A flat zip up pouch (2 sided) I already have a string idea of layout, colours, branding etc, but I'm looking for someone with strong typography/layout and graphic design skills to make it pop. Please give some examples of packing that you have designed in the past
19 days ago57 proposalsRemote
Past "Bead-stringing" Projects
I need html code and url passthrough code
We have a Showit website and Thrivecart checkout. We need to dynamically passthrough information from the URL someone uses to access the showit page to Thrivecart. We have the passthrough information Thrivecart requires (see this page: https://support.thrivecart.com/help/pre-fill-your-checkout-fields/ and this page: https://support.thrivecart.com/help/passing-custom-variables-through-the-checkout/ But we cannot get the code we have to append the URL information to the checkout link on the showit page. This is the code we have but try as we might it just is not working for us! Document document.addEventListener(“DOMContentLoaded”, function() { // Get the current page’s query string var queryString = window.location.search; // Check if there actually is a query string if (queryString) { // Select all anchor tags on the page var links = document.querySelectorAll(‘a’); // Loop through each link links.forEach(function(link) { // Construct the new URL by checking if a query string already exists var newHref = link.href; if (link.href.includes(‘?’)) { // If the link already has a query string, append using ‘&’ newHref += ‘&’ + queryString.substring(1); } else { // If no query string exists, append directly newHref += queryString; } // Update the href attribute of the link link.setAttribute(‘href’, newHref); }); } }); What we are looking for from you: The complete task to write the code to dynamically get the information from the URL and add to the checkout link to send to thrivecart. The correct information to add to the checkout link Proof it works. Instructions for us to add to all our sales pages and products in future builds. Please note the information MUST be taken dynamically from the URL bar.
opportunitypre-funded
FOX ESS API Interface
c# Wpf application to access retrieve and display ( graphically and table preferred ) but table as a minimum and store results in a sql lite db - Source code must be included. lowest cost will score highly - Second API interface for alternate solar array may beaded at later date - fast turn around needed - API Details can be found here https://www.foxesscloud.com/public/i18n/en/OpenApiDocument.html#get20the20number20of20public20interface20accesses0a3ca20id3dget20the20number20of20public20interface20accesses4323e203ca3e
IOS app development (Swift developer)
- I want to create an image using Midjourney API. -The screen should be 1 screen for input and output (1 screen for input and 1 screen for output if layout is difficult). -Inputs are image (selected from the device) and text (randomly entered by the user), and 5 buttons to tap on either. -Combine the prompt string that associates the text with the tapped button and pass the combined string and image to the Midjourney API (img2img). If no image is selected, pass only the combined string to the API (txt2img) - Receive the image from the API and display it. - When the user taps the save button, the displayed image is saved to the smartphone. That's it. It's a relatively simple app, but the deadline is tight and strict. Looking for swift developer who can finish by April 2 to complete the revision. I am looking for a reliable developer who can work with us for the long term. If you are confident, please contact to me. Best regards
Fix error in Python-based web scraper wit GUI
Hello Freelancers, I'm searching for a developer familiar with web scraping and Python to fix an existing web scraper which scrapes product data from products from category links from italian ecommerce-website www.yeppon.it The script basically works, but it gives an error on certain points when scraping, I think because of a light change in the structure of the website which causes an error when the script tries to scrape a products text description. Goal of this project is to fix the errors so the script works like it used to again, scraping data of products from given category-URLs from the website and giving out the data in csv-files. I think this won't be too much of an effort because it is basically this one error which needs to be located and fixed, everything else still seems to work fine. Price can be discussed. Some facts: 1. The web scraper is based on Python with a GUI. It's final version comes as an exe file (therefore I can't attach it in the project description, I will send it in the messages or work stream). 2. It scrapes certain product data (like product name, price, description, image links) by category links which can be entered into the GUI. The GUI also has some input fields, these are just for fixed strings which can be entered into the fields and will be given out in the CSV files the script gives the product data in. 3. The scraper technically still works, however, it gives an error when scraping certain categories. You can check this by running the tool, filling out the given input fields with the data explained in the "Instructions" tab of the tool and then start scraping. It will produce this error (can be found in the log file): -------------------------------------------------------------------------------------------------------------- 2024-04-24 12:44:24,765:ERROR:'descriptionHtml' Traceback (most recent call last): File "async_scraper.py", line 739, in scrape description_html = pdata["pageProps"]["product"][ 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 KeyError: 'descriptionHtml' 2024-04-24 12:44:24,765:INFO: Finally 2024-04-24 12:44:24,765:INFO: No data found! ------------------------------------------------------------------------------------------------------------------ 4. The error seems to occur when scraping a products text description. The text description consists of three possible elements: - bulletpoints formatted into an ul element - a text description which is cleaned/has HTML code removed/replaced - scraping data from a table on the website and putting it into a given HTML structure It was developed by a freelancer from PPH for a colleague of mine, unfortunately I can't reach my colleague for quite some time now to ask for all the details or the freelancers name, so I will post this to the public. Scraping some categories will result in the error mentioned above, for example: https://www.yeppon.it/c/elettrodomestici/grandi-elettrodomestici/asciugabiancheria or https://www.yeppon.it/c/elettrodomestici/grandi-elettrodomestici/frigoriferi Others work just fine, like: https://www.yeppon.it/c/telefonia/smartphone/smart-phone I will attach the files I have about this project from my colleague. As I can't attach exe or rar files, I attached: - a first version of the Python code (it is a beta version which will give another error which is solved in the final exe file and not the final code, just to give you an impression), as well as the code of the GUI and the requirements. These are async_scraper.txt, gui.txt and requirements.txt
opportunity
Modifications to Excel VBA Program
User requires enhancements to an Excel VBA program, String Match Correction, written for Excel 2010. The Program performs search, logic and comparison operations, metrics and scoring, and string manipulation between two Excel music data spreadsheets. The enhancements are required to accommodate a newly developed spreadsheet (Singles) and changes and additions to the field names of existing (AlbumCD and Tapes) spreadsheets. The task involves developing new VBA coding, integrating and modifying existing VBA coding to expand the automated spell checking, data comparison, metrics, scoring, and data editing features of the VBA Program’s functionality for the three Excel data spreadsheets, Tapes, AlbumCD, and Singles. Contact Buyer for spreadsheet and current UI views
Help with Dapper code
Please see my feedback/ many projects. I have a simple controller. I want to replace the hardcoded json with a Dapper link to an Access database table. So the GET/POST/DELETE etc connects to the Access database and provides an endpoint. Code looks like this so far - it's a project sample that works in Swagger: ############################## using Microsoft.AspNetCore.Mvc; namespace API.Controllers { [ApiController] [Route("[controller]")] public class WeatherForecastController : ControllerBase { private static readonly string[] Summaries = new[] { "Freezing", "Bracing", "Chilly", "CoolX", "Mild", "Warm", "Balmy", "Hot", "Sweltering", "Scorching" }; private readonly ILogger _logger; public WeatherForecastController(ILogger logger) { _logger = logger; } [HttpGet(Name = "GetWeatherForecast")] public IEnumerable new WeatherForecast { Date = DateOnly.FromDateTime(DateTime.Now.AddDays(index)), TemperatureC = Random.Shared.Next(-20, 55), Summary = Summaries[Random.Shared.Next(Summaries.Length)] }) .ToArray(); } } } ####################################################### It's for creating quick API samples. Thanks
Research eBay prices and put information into Google Sheet
I have a Google Sheet which has a column called 'ebay search string' for example: iPhone 11 64gb unlocked This should be used on the ebay.co.uk website with (buy it now price, sort by price + postage low to high, UK only items, used condition) to find listings for sale. Once done, you would need to pay attention to detail. Avoiding any faulty items (please look at the picture of the listing to avoid cracked/faulty screens, item title and description). The job here is to find the 3 'cheapest' working items in 'good condition' which matches the search string and place the URLs and prices in the Google sheet. For example: URL 1 Price for URL 1 URL 2 Price for URL 2 URL 3 (Please also see attachment for example) This needs to be done for 390 lines in the sheet. Happy to share the sheet upon proposal.
We need people who can make hats and beanies
We are for three types of people: 1. People who can sew/make beanies and hats based on the model/sample 2. People, who can add handmade features to those hats and beanies (pompom, beads, ribbons, tassels and etc) 3. People, who can do hand/machine embroidery
I need a Photo Re-touched; Improved
Hi, I need a 3 things touched up on a photo. 1) eliminate the creepy skin where chest meets neck by the string necklace 2) make the chest smoother overall in appearance. 3) eliminate few hairs under chin missed in shaving. Thank you! Michael
Website TLC
I need a developer happy to work with wordpress elementor website to solve an urgent coding problem as soon as possible and then to work with regularly to maintain health of website and help with some SEO. I'm a wedding dressmaker designer with an established site: carolinearthur.com, which has a web app (/couture-kit page) within it. I am happy to manage the content for the site, but can't access the app. I'm told the Database utility file needs to be updated in all the folders I have for the website. My host (Heart) has reverted the PHP version to 7.2 from 8.1 which seems to have been the catalyst for a "Fatal error" occuring. But this means I'm on borrowed time as I understand 7.2 is nearing or at end of life? I understand the problem is within the code. My PHP script uses deprecated functions and strings that are no longer working with PHP 8.1, so we need to review the code. I have been given the logs to look at, but have no idea what that means! Please help Caroline
SWIFT, add a line of code that detects current url of webview
Below is the code. All I need is to have a variable that continuously retrieves the current url as a string. Then I can run an if conditional on the url string. Should take less than an hour for those who have done this before. I will pay one hour at a rate of $35 euro as long as it works, and the code functions as it does now conditionally based on retrieving the url as a string (as you can see in the code) Just an fyi: I understand spying can be for national security purposes and such. Though if you are spying on me, and acting upon it and implementing restrictions, such as altering markets, intruding, hacking, etc., even with an intention of thinking you can help me, I will treat it as war / terrorism, so be responsible for those you love and care about as wars/terrorism affect others too. Don't disrespect me by spying if you aren't doing it for some sort of war / defense effort, especially if you act upon it without informing me. Defense efforts should not involve me as I have absolutely no association with any entity as I am a sole business owner. If you have paranoia about potential corrupt businesses and scams, just ask me and I will show you what you need to see. This is not a scam by any means. Doing anything that affects someone behind their back without informing them is completely unacceptable, as you need to have courage and confidence and perhaps humility, resulting in informing people explicitly and asking questions rather than paranoid spy efforts hoping to figure out what is going on with something you might not understand. This is meant to be a weed out, as I have experienced too much of what I am describing in the past. If you meet the above criteria, then thanks for your interest and I look forward to a simple job being completed. import UIKit import WebKit import Foundation class ViewController: UIViewController, WKUIDelegate, WKNavigationDelegate{ var web_view: WKWebView! override func viewDidLoad() { super.viewDidLoad() // Do any additional setup after loading the view. let progressDialog = UIAlertController(title: nil, message: "LoadingData...", preferredStyle: .alert) progressDialog.addAction(UIAlertAction(title: "Cancel", style: .cancel, handler: nil)) web_view.scrollView.showsVerticalScrollIndicator = true web_view.scrollView.bounces = true web_view.scrollView.isScrollEnabled = true web_view.scrollView.alwaysBounceVertical = true web_view.scrollView.keyboardDismissMode = .onDrag web_view.uiDelegate = self if #available(iOS 12.0, *) { web_view.scrollView.contentInsetAdjustmentBehavior = .never } let myURL = URL(string: "https://domain.com/founduserdefaultvkeys1.php") let myRequest = URLRequest(url: myURL!) web_view.load(myRequest) // I JUST NEED THE ABILITY TO RETRIEVE THE CURRENT URL AS A STRING SO I CAN RUN A CONDITIONAL ON IT // for example: let weburl = url.absoluteString // I need the weburl variable available here // if weburl.starts(with:"https://domain.com/detecturlyet.html")) { let useDefaults = UserDefaults.standard let secretcode = "1234" let savedEmail = "testemail@prioriteasy.com" useDefaults.synchronize() useDefaults.removeObject(forKey: "email_key") useDefaults.removeObject(forKey: "secret_code") useDefaults.set("testemail@prioriteasy.com", forKey: "email_key") useDefaults.set(secretcode, forKey: "secret_code") useDefaults.synchronize() if let savedEmail = useDefaults.string(forKey: "email_key") { let sendurl = "https://prioriteasy.com/founduserdefaultvkeys2.php?getemail=\(savedEmail)&secret=\(secretcode)" web_view.load(URLRequest(url: URL(string: sendurl)!)) } web_view.allowsBackForwardNavigationGestures = true } override func loadView() { let webConfiguration = WKWebViewConfiguration() web_view = WKWebView(frame: .zero, configuration: webConfiguration) web_view.navigationDelegate = self view = web_view } func webView(_ webView: WKWebView, createWebViewWith configuration: WKWebViewConfiguration, for navigationAction: WKNavigationAction, windowFeatures: WKWindowFeatures) -> WKWebView? { guard let url = navigationAction.request.url else { return nil } guard let targetFrame = navigationAction.targetFrame, targetFrame.isMainFrame else { webView.load(URLRequest(url: url)) return nil } return nil } }
Wall panel design needed with cutting file
I would like wall panel design for my living room, hallway and staircase with landing and also master bedroom. The spaces are small so I need someone experienced who can best design the wall panels. I only want the beading panels. I would like someone who is experienced in this as I will need design direction and get the sizes right Example attached
Create a Python-based web scraper
Build and deploy a Python-based web application that can: • Crawl a wide range of corporate and news websites for pages and documents containing relevant information, based on search terms that can be either set or manually input. • The crawler can be set to automatically run at set frequencies or run manually. • The crawler should be broadly as effective as a reasonably comprehensive Google search e.g. should return the majority of the results from the equivalent first two Google results pages. • Scrapes those pages and documents for the relevant information (predominantly text strings) and compiles it into some sort of data lake/unstructured store ready for later analysis and structuring. The application should be cloud hosted and the freelancer will need to also set this hosting up (install Python virtually etc) and handover to me with necessary demonstrations/explanations. Additional information and examples can be shared with interested freelancers following signature of an NDA. Further work may follow if this project is successful. Please indicate in your response how many hours you expect this work to take.
List View (Dropdown) with submenues for Unity 3D
I need a programmer for a List View (Dropdown) with submenues for Unity 3D with the following specifications: - Dropdown with submenues - Adding new items - name an rename items - checkboxes for activate/deactive each item - change the order o f the items via drag and drop We'd also have to be able to initialize the menu content and status from code and also read out the content and status of a given dropdown. Like having the name, order and active/inactive status of the items in a list be readable from (to set up a list) and saveable to (for later use) a json string. So we're not working with static menus that are only set up once in the editor.
pre-funded
List View (Dropdown) with submenues for Unity 3D
I need a programmer for a List View (Dropdown) with submenues for Unity 3D with the following specifications: - Dropdown with submenues - Adding new items - name an rename items - checkboxes for activate/deactive each item - change the order o f the items via drag and drop One more detail: We'd also have to be able to initialize the menu content and status from code and also read out the content and status of a given dropdown. Like having the name, order and active/inactive status of the items in a list be readable from (to set up a list) and saveable to (for later use) a json string. So we're not working with static menus that are only set up once in the editor.
I need a tech pack
I need a tech pack for my clothing brand designs. I am currently working on 3-4 pieces that will include denim and beading. If this is something you can assist with, please get in touch.
Implement ffmpeg hardware acceleration on Raspberry Pi 4
I have a Raspberry Pi 4 which is to transcode ts (mpeg2) files to mp4 (mpeg4) files using ffmpeg. the outcome is 1 properly configured/compiled ffmpeg for working hw acceleration on the host 2 a list of terminal commands to achieve this configuration 3 an ffmpeg command string to achieve the transcode it appears that the host ffmpeg is already compiled with omx and mmal, but I can't confirm it. It should be a 1 or 2 hour job if you know what you are doing. The host is configured as a server, I will give you remote access over SSH.
opportunity
Bubble payment plug in
Hi, We need you to create a working bubble payment plugin with parameters shown below. Project time frame around 3 weeks. After that you will give us 2 around weeks time to test the plug in. The payment will proceed after plug will be successfully tested and working. Budget negotiable. Structure of data request The plug-in should send data of the form in POST method. Address: https://www.paysera.com/pay/ There are always 2 fields sent: data and sign. Generating request fields from parameters 1. All parameters are joined to a URL-encoded string. For example: 2. ['param1' => 'abc', 'param2' => 'Some string with symbols %=&'] 3. 'param1=abc¶m2=Some+string+with+symbols+%25%3D%26' It should be the equivalent of the PHP function http_build_query 4. The result string is encoded in base64 encoding. For example: 5. 'param1=abc¶m2=Some+string+with+symbols+%25%3D%26' 6. 'cGFyYW0xPWFiYyZwYXJhbTI9U29tZStzdHJpbmcrd2l0aCtzeW1ib2xzKyUyNSUzRCUyNg==' It should be the equivalent of PHP function base64_encode 7. In the result string symbols "/" are replaced with "_", and symbols "+" with "-". We get similar to base64 encoding, which is safe to send in URL without further processing. For example: 8. 'MViDYlV7V0iHR2w2OkJjRFFpY11hizJDhk+EZjl/' 9. 'MViDYlV7V0iHR2w2OkJjRFFpY11hizJDhk-EZjl_' It should be the equivalent of PHP function str_replace or strtr. 10. The final result string is signed - the sign parameter is generated. Algorithm to generate sign parameter: sign = md5(data + password) Here md5 is the cryptographic hash function, data - encoded parameters, password - our project password which we should be able to enter in the plug-in. Parameters we should be able to get from our database and input in the above: ALL PARAMETERS ARE ALL THE TIME DIFFERENT, SO IT MUST TAKE EACH PARAMETER INDIVIDUALLY FROM THE DATABASE OR FROM THE INPUT BOX! Parameter – Length - Description projectid - 11 - Unique project number from our system. orderid – 40 - Order number from our system. accepturl – 255 - Full address (URL), to which the client is directed after a successful operation. cancelurl – 255 - Full address (URL), to which the client is directed after he clicks the link to return. callbackurl - 255 - Full address (URL), to which we will get information about performed payment. Script must return text "OK". version - 9 - The version number of system specification (API). Link from payment provider: https://developers.paysera.com/en/checkout/integrations/integration-specification NB! Our specification is a bit different so please don't use this link as the main source.